int
是32位整數;一個long
是一個64位整數。使用哪一個取決於您希望使用的數字的大小。
int
和long
是原始類型,而Integer
和Long
是對象。原始類型更高效,但有時您需要使用對象;例如,Java的集合類只能與對象一起工作,所以如果需要整數列表,則必須使其成為List<Integer>
(例如,您不能直接在List
中使用int
)。
int
是32位整數;一個long
是一個64位整數。使用哪一個取決於您希望使用的數字的大小。
int
和long
是原始類型,而Integer
和Long
是對象。原始類型更高效,但有時您需要使用對象;例如,Java的集合類只能與對象一起工作,所以如果需要整數列表,則必須使其成為List<Integer>
(例如,您不能直接在List
中使用int
)。
本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。